Survivors of New Zealand mosque attack prepare to face shooter

On March 15, 2019, an Australian terrorist opened fire on two Christchurch mosques killing 51 worshippers. Source: AAP
Survivors of the 2019 Christchurch Mosque shooting are set to confront the gunman, when they deliver victim impact statements at a sentencing hearing.
